 The Buddha taught the "Five Faculties" as a framework for motivation and spiritual development: 1. **Faith (Saddha):** Faith refers to confidence and trust in the teachings of the Buddha, the path to enlightenment, and one's own potential to awaken. It provides the initial inspiration and motivation to embark on the spiritual journey. 2. **Effort (Virya):** Effort involves the persistent exertion of energy toward wholesome actions, such as meditation, ethical conduct, and cultivating positive mental states. It is the driving force behind progress on the spiritual path. 3. **Mindfulness (Sati):** Mindfulness is the ability to be fully present and aware of one's thoughts, feelings, sensations, and actions in the present moment.  Top 10 famous places in mandalay Sure, here are the top 10 famous places in Mandalay, Myanmar: 1. Mandalay Royal Palace: The former royal residence of the last Burmese monarchy. 2. Shwenandaw Monastery: A historic wooden monastery known for its intricate carvings. 3. Kuthodaw Pagoda: Home to the "world's largest book," a collection of stone inscriptions. 4. Mandalay Hill: A sacred hill with panoramic views of the city and surrounding countryside. 5. Mahamuni Buddha Temple: Housing a highly venerated Buddha image covered in thick layers of gold leaf. 6. U Bein Bridge: The longest teakwood bridge in the world, offering stunning sunset views. 7. Atumashi Monastery: A reconstructed monastery with impressive architecture and design. 8. Maha Aung Mye Bonzan Monastery (Me Nu Oak Kyaung): A beautifully preserved monastery dating back to the Konbaung Dynasty. 9.  Top 10 famous places of myanmar Myanmar, formerly known as Burma, is a country rich in history, culture, and natural beauty. Here are ten famous places in Myanmar: 1. Shwedagon Pagoda, Yangon: A gilded stupa that is the most sacred Buddhist pagoda in Myanmar. 2. Bagan: An ancient city with thousands of temples, pagodas, and stupas scattered across the landscape. 3. Inle Lake: A picturesque freshwater lake famous for its floating gardens, stilt villages, and leg-rowing fishermen. 4. Mandalay: The second-largest city in Myanmar, known for its royal palace, numerous monasteries, and the iconic U Bein Bridge. 5. Golden Rock (Kyaiktiyo Pagoda): A sacred Buddhist site featuring a gold-leaf-covered boulder perched precariously on the edge of a cliff. 6. Yangon (Rangoon): The largest city and former capital of Myanmar, home to colonial-era buildings, bustling markets, and the Sule Pagoda. 7.
